A delicate, calligraphic script with pronounced thick–thin modulation and long, tapering entry/exit strokes. Letterforms are largely upright with a narrow, vertical rhythm, featuring frequent loops, teardrop terminals, and sweeping ascenders/descenders that create lively silhouettes. Connections appear fluid and handwriting-led, while capitals add decorative swashes and occasional dramatic downstrokes. Counters are small and the overall texture is open and light, with occasional weighty strokes used as emphasis in key parts of the forms.
This font works best for short display settings such as wedding stationery, invitations, greeting cards, boutique branding, and premium packaging where elegance and personality are the priority. It can also serve as an accent for pull quotes or headings when paired with a restrained text face.
The tone is graceful and romantic, with a light, airy sophistication that feels suited to celebratory or personal messaging. Its looping joins and gentle flourishes suggest formality without heaviness, leaning toward charming and expressive rather than strict or utilitarian.
The design intention reads as a formal, handwritten script that prioritizes graceful movement and decorative flair. By combining fine hairline connections with selective heavier strokes and swashed capitals, it aims to deliver an upscale, expressive signature-like look for display typography.
Capitals are especially decorative and can occupy noticeably more visual space than lowercase, creating a strong headline presence. Some glyphs show pronounced contrast between hairline connectors and bold stems, which adds sparkle but can make spacing and readability feel more sensitive at smaller sizes.
